In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: can: bcm: defer rx_op deallocation to workqueue to fix thrtimer UAF Commit… (CVE-2026-72123)CVE-2026-72123 0 A use-after-free (UAF) vulnerability in the Linux kernel's CAN BCM driver was resolved by deferring timer cancellation and memory deallocation to a dedicated workqueue. The flaw involved a race condition where a high-resolution timer could access freed memory after an RCU grace period, potentially causing kernel instability.
